#ef7198 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ef7198 is composed of 93.7% red, 44.3%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 52.7% magenta, 36.4%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 341.4 degrees, a saturation of 79.7% and a lightness of 69%. #ef7198 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e2ff with #df0031. Closest websafe color is: #ff6699.

#ef7198 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ef7198 has RGB values of R:239, G:113,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.53, Y:0.36,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 15692184.

Shades and Tints of #ef7198
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110206 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.
